MooVId speedtest, using the following MooVId commandline template:
MooVId fps 1000 noskip verbose nosound nogui [filename]
(and dither pip, dither overlay, and winp in various modes)
Used MooVId version: 1.2

Used animation was Rave.mov, 320x240, CinePak codec original framerate was 15FPS.

Testconfiguration:
A1200/BPPC 603e+/233MHz, 68040/33Mhz, BVisionPPC, 80MB RAM, CGX 4.2

68040/33 results:

Overlay: 33.5 fps
Own Screen: 33.56 fps
Windowplayback: 17.1 fps
Storm dither (AGA): 12.69 fps

PowerUP:

Overlay: 39.16 fps
Own screen: 47.95 fps
Windowplayback: 20.31 fps
Storm dither (AGA): 17.9 fps

WarpOS:

Overlay: 49.32 fps
Own Screen: 73.91 fps
Windowplayback: 23.66 fps
Storm dither (AGA): 25.12 fps

Same animation on my system:
A4000/CSMKII 060-50/PicassoIV, 174MB RAM, CGX4.2, p96 2.0, OS3.1

AGA:
Storm dither (AGA): 19.52fps

Under p96:
Overlay: 98.97fps
Own Screen: 63.26fps
Windowplayback (on hicolor screen): 66.85fps
Windowplayback (on truecolor screen): 50.53fps

Under CGX:

Overlay: 75.30fps
Own Screen: 53.64fps
Windowplayback (on hicolor screen): 30.30fps
Windowplayback (on truecolor screen): 23.2fps

Note:
There are major slowdowns using CGX or PowerUP systems...
There will be some speed improvement under PowerUP, so that will be near same speed as WOS version, but the main problem is the CGX, because in many operations (window playback, and overlay) under CGX is far more slower than under p96.
